šŸ† Wellness Wednesday WIN: Listening to My Body
My sleep is slowly getting better… and I’m finally listening to my body and allowing myself to REST. The other day I sat down exhausted and couldn’t figure out why I felt so drained. Did the math and had a lightbulb moment šŸ’” — I was only giving my body ONE recovery day when I normally need TWO minimum. I normally do HIIT classes Wednesdays and Saturdays. But because I am in this 6 weeks challenge we have to tally up our score board points by Monday so I was attending Mondays too šŸ¤·šŸ»ā€ā™€ļø!! I was being an overachiever not realizing and jeopardize my recoveryšŸ¤¦šŸ»ā€ā™€ļø So this week, I adjusted. Gave myself those two recovery days… and I’m slowly getting back to normal. Busy life. Busy mom. But I found the root cause and corrected it. That’s growth. Today is my recovery day. Tomorrow… Beast Mode Problems šŸ’ŖšŸ”„ Hope my Skool community is having a wonderful mid-week. Listen to your body — it always tells the truth. šŸ’›
